Looking for a spot to mark a birthday, anniversary, or just a win at work? London’s got a mix of iconic sites and hidden gems that fit any budget and vibe. Below you’ll find easy‑to‑follow ideas that let you skip the guesswork and jump straight into the fun.
When the wallet is tight, the city’s calendar is still packed. Check out the weekly free concerts in Hyde Hyde’s park, the street art festivals in Shoreditch, or the seasonal fireworks along the Thames. Most of these events start early, so grab a picnic blanket, some takeaway snacks, and claim a spot before the crowd arrives.
If you love culture, the free museum evenings on the first Friday of each month are perfect. Many galleries stay open late, offer live music, and even host happy‑hour drinks. It’s a classy way to celebrate without paying an entry fee.

If nature is your backdrop, head to one of the best parks for a date or group gathering—Regent’s Park or Greenwich Park both have sprawling lawns, scenic views, and nearby cafés for a quick bite.
When you need a quick “wow” factor, the London Eye offers private capsule hire. You can pop a bottle of bubbly, watch the city lights, and capture photos that look straight out of a travel magazine.
Don’t forget the seasonal twists: a Christmas market in Southbank, a summer open‑air cinema near the Tower Bridge, or a spring flower show in Kew Gardens. Each event adds a festive layer to your celebration.
